Oracle数据库管理实战:从创建到恢复

需积分: 10 2 下载量 30 浏览量 更新于2024-07-16 收藏 8.32MB PDF 举报
"Oracle_Database11g-Administration_Workshop2-1-1212.pdf" 本资料是Oracle Database 11g管理实践课程的学生指南,涵盖了数据库架构、安装、创建、管理等多个方面的内容,旨在帮助用户深入理解和操作Oracle数据库系统。 1. **Oracle数据库架构探索**:这部分介绍Oracle数据库的基础结构,包括数据库实例、数据文件、控制文件、重做日志文件等,以及它们在数据库运行中的作用。 2. **Oracle软件安装**:详细讲解如何安装Oracle数据库软件,包括先决条件、安装过程、配置步骤等,确保用户能够正确安装并启动数据库服务。 3. **使用DBCA创建数据库**:DBCA(Database Configuration Assistant)是一种图形化工具,用于自动化数据库的创建和配置。此部分将指导用户如何使用DBCA创建一个新的Oracle数据库。 4. **数据库实例管理**:介绍如何启动、关闭数据库实例,以及管理SPFILE、PFILE等实例参数文件,确保数据库正常运行。 5. **ASM实例管理**:ASM(Automatic Storage Management)是Oracle的集成存储管理系统,学习如何配置和管理ASM实例,优化存储资源的使用。 6. **网络环境配置**:涵盖TCP/IP网络基础,以及如何使用NETCA(Network Configuration Assistant)配置监听器、服务名等网络组件,确保数据库的网络连通性。 7. **数据库存储结构管理**:讨论数据表空间、段、区和块等存储概念,以及如何创建、扩展和调整这些存储结构,以满足不同业务需求。 8. **用户安全管理员**:介绍Oracle的权限和角色管理,包括用户创建、权限分配、口令策略和审计机制,以保障数据库的安全性。 9. **并发数据管理**:讲解多用户环境下如何控制并发访问,如锁定、行级锁定、事务管理等,防止数据冲突。 10. **回滚数据管理**:阐述撤销(Undo)数据的重要性,如何配置undo表空间,以及如何处理回滚事务,保持数据库的一致性。 11. **实施数据库审计**:介绍Oracle的审计功能,包括系统审计、对象审计和细粒度审计,用于跟踪和记录数据库活动,满足合规性和安全性需求。 12. **数据库维护**:涉及定期的数据库维护任务,如数据库性能监控、统计信息收集、索引维护等,确保数据库高效运行。 13. **性能管理**:涵盖SQL优化、数据库调优、AWR(Automatic Workload Repository)报告分析,以及如何使用ADDM(Automatic Database Diagnostic Monitor)进行性能诊断。 14. **备份与恢复概念**:介绍Oracle的备份策略,包括冷备份、热备份、RMAN(Recovery Manager)备份,理解备份的重要性及恢复的基本原理。 15. **执行数据库备份**:详细讲解如何使用RMAN执行数据库备份,包括全量备份、增量备份和差异备份,以及备份验证和备份集管理。 16. **执行数据库恢复**:涵盖恢复类型,如不完全恢复、媒体恢复,以及如何使用RMAN进行数据库和数据文件的恢复操作。 17. **数据迁移**:讨论数据泵(Data Pump)、SQL*Loader等工具,用于数据迁移、导入导出,实现数据在不同数据库之间的移动。 18. **与支持合作**:介绍如何与Oracle支持团队协作,解决数据库问题,包括故障排查、日志分析和问题报告。 这份指南全面覆盖了Oracle Database 11g的管理和运维知识,是数据库管理员提升技能、解决问题的重要参考资料。